Episode description

In this episode, I virtually sit down with fellow podcaster Chinae Alexander! We discuss meeting her boyfriend on tinder, why opposites are good in dating, where you should be 1.5 years in, how often you should have sex with your SO, her experience getting COVID19, wanting something serious but not wanting to push someone away, when to tell someone what you're looking for, and more. This episode starts with a solo where I discuss post hookup anxiety, deleting dating apps, running out of things to talk about in therapy, when to discuss family drama, dating with a chronic illness, and running into an ex.
